About Daniele Viganò

Daniele Viganò is a scholar working on Astronomy and Astrophysics, Geophysics and Nuclear and High Energy Physics, having authored 79 papers that have together received 2.4k indexed citations. Recurring topics across this work include Pulsars and Gravitational Waves Research (52 papers), Astrophysical Phenomena and Observations (32 papers), High-pressure geophysics and materials (22 papers), Gamma-ray bursts and supernovae (20 papers), Geophysics and Gravity Measurements (11 papers), earthquake and tectonic studies (8 papers), Astrophysics and Cosmic Phenomena (8 papers) and Astro and Planetary Science (7 papers). The work is most often cited by research in Astronomy and Astrophysics (1.3k citations), Geophysics (975 citations) and Civil and Structural Engineering (591 citations). Daniele Viganò has collaborated with scholars based in Spain, Italy and Germany. Frequent co-authors include J. A. Pons, N. Rea, J. A. Miralles, Rosalba Perna, Carlos Palenzuela, Marco Pagani, Michele Simionato, Vítor Silva, Helen Crowley and Graeme Weatherill. Their work appears in journals such as The Astrophysical Journal, Monthly Notices of the Royal Astronomical Society and Nature Physics.
